Transaction 66fd9149efe2350fc49f268953eb7fb35ea636828e83e95ef1764981ed3e14e4
1 Input
1 Output
-
66fd9149efe2350fc49f268953eb7fb35ea636828e83e95ef1764981ed3e14e4:0
- value
- 97436000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70968e501cf138bb2c9f8af40438b90173899681 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BGK3HziYRNZd1LD9BjZefhNZY4BxWHwhy